## Migrating Cron Jobs to Flowspindle

As release manager, you own the cutover of the nightly reconciliation crons into Flowspindle workflows. Migrate one job per release, keep the legacy cron disabled but present for two cycles, and confirm parity in the Dredgemoor staging logs before removal. Each workflow bundle must be signed prior to promotion. Sign every bundle with the deploy key shown below.

rollout seal: bky4_x7Gc

TICKET #982 — Export retry vault locked

New folks: the Quillbatch vault that stores export-retry credentials has auto-locked again. Failed exports are piling up in the dead-letter queue and can't be retried until it's open.

Unlock via the ops console, recovery mode, confirm twice. Don't skip the audit note.

At the final prompt, enter the recovery passphrase shown here:

strongbox words: silath-briwyn-julox-olimir-raldor-zorwyn-ralius-ralwyn-belius-sildor

The rule-severity matrix changed significantly in version three, and older design notes are misleading. Please also review the fixture corpus conventions before adding test feeds, as naming affects the CI matrix. The authoritative architecture notes, severity matrix, and fixture guidelines are maintained on the internal page below.

dashboard of yahaf-kajep = https://jira.zemvarsys.internal/display/projects/browse/browse/a08b